Wide Area Network (WAN) allow companies to extend their network over a large geographical area, but when companies try to expand their network to even larger area and not to forget across multiple carriers’ networks, they face major operational challenges. Software-defined wide area network (SD-WAN) overcomes these networking challenges, by separating networking hardware from its control mechanism. Gartner, predicts that up to 25% of users will manage their WAN through software within two years. Revenue from SD-WAN vendors is growing at 59% annually, Gartner estimates, and it’s expected to become a $1.3 billion market by 2020.

1. SD-WAN: AN OVERVIEW
The software-defined wide area network (SD-WAN) is a specific application of software-defined
networking (SDN) technology applied to WAN connections, which are used to connect
enterprise networks – including branch offices and data centers – over large geographic
distances.
A WAN might be used, for example, to connect branch offices to a central corporate network,
or to connect data centers separated by distance. In the past, these WAN connections often
used technology that required special proprietary hardware. The SD-WAN movement seeks to
move more of the network control is moved into the “cloud,” using a software approach.

Current WAN architecture has few challenges like
Traditional connectivity with costly MPLS causing inefficiency of using diverse
applications.
Lack of network security and reliability features
Lack of optimization of SaaS and cloud based services within network
Lack of automated provisioning of resources
